A weight carrying or “dead weight” ball
mount is one that is designed to carry the
whole amount of tongue weight and gross
weight directly on the ball mount and on
the receiver.
The hitch ball is attached to the ball mount
and the ball mount is inserted into the hitch
receiver. Choose a proper class ball mount
based on the trailer weight...

The TSR system provides the driver with
information about the most recently detected
speed limit. The system captures
the road sign information with the multisensing
front camera unit located on
the windshield in front of the inside rearview
mirror and displays the detected
signs in the vehicle information display...
